Credit: theravada.gr The Greek Buddhist monk Nyanadassana has been a senior monk of the ancient Buddhist Theravada tradition for 37 years in Sri Lanka. Nanyadasana was born in 1959 as Ioannis Tselios in Serres, northern Greece. At the age of 64, after an unusual life, he has become an important Buddhist monk and scholar with many books to his credit, international acclai…
